【中文】一种基于QT自动生成代码的方法及装置 【EN】Method and device for automatically generating codes based on QT

摘要:【中文】本发明公开了一种基于QT自动生成代码的方法,包括输入符合规范的XSD文件并定义XML文件的架构,解析所述XSD文件,根据所述XSD文件中对XML文件的约束生成对应的类属性和成员变量,识别所述XSD文件中的指示器,将XSD文件中的所有element元素根据文件结构生成相应的element哈希表,将所述element元素根据是否复合结构、最小出现次数、最大出现次数生成相应的代码,通过Q_CLASSINFO记录生成的列表类型成员变量元素,生成头文件和源代码文件。该方法解决了现有技术中手工编写对应XML文件的转换代码的工作,存在效率低下的问题。 【EN】The invention discloses a method for automatically generating codes based on QT, which comprises the steps of inputting an XSD file which meets the specification, defining the framework of the XML file, analyzing the XSD file, generating corresponding class attributes and member variables according to the constraint of the XSD file on the XML file, identifying an indicator in the XSD file, generating corresponding element hash tables for all element elements in the XSD file according to the file structure, generating corresponding codes for the element elements according to whether a composite structure is formed or not, the minimum occurrence frequency and the maximum occurrence frequency, recording the generated list type member variable elements through Q _ CLASSINFO, and generating a header file and a source code file. The method solves the problem of low efficiency in the prior art due to the work of manually compiling the conversion codes of the corresponding XML files.

【中文】一种RSSP-I安全通信的安全校验方法 【EN】Security verification method for RSSP-I secure communication

摘要:【中文】本发明公开了一种RSSP‑I安全通信的安全校验方法,包括以下步骤:获取移位寄存器值作为时间戳值,所述时间戳值的生成多项式为本原多项式,以所述本原多项式为基准,利用伽罗瓦线性反馈移位算法对所述本原多项式进行处理,获取伪随机数值,根据所述伪随机序列值对安全通信进行安全校验,获取有效报文。其中移位寄存器值的生成多项式采用了本原多项式来提高伪随机序列值,进而提升了RSSP‑I通信协议的安全性,并且使用伽罗瓦线性反馈移位算法计算量小,实现起来比较简洁有效。 【EN】The invention discloses a security verification method for RSSP-I security communication, which comprises the following steps: the method comprises the steps of obtaining a shift register value as a time stamp value, enabling a generator polynomial of the time stamp value to be a primitive polynomial, processing the primitive polynomial by utilizing a Galois linear feedback shift algorithm by taking the primitive polynomial as a reference to obtain a pseudo-random number value, and carrying out safety check on safety communication according to the pseudo-random sequence value to obtain an effective message. The generator polynomial of the shift register value adopts the primitive polynomial to improve the pseudo-random sequence value, so that the safety of the RSSP-I communication protocol is improved, the calculation amount of the Galois linear feedback shift algorithm is small, and the implementation is simple and effective.
